Amarillo, TX (PRWEB) October 17, 2004

MicroFour, Inc., a leader in practice management systems and electronic medical record (EMR) design, recently celebrated its 16th birthday. In 1988, three brothers – Brett, Jay and Steve Taylor and their sister, Cynthia Johnson launched the MicroFour practice management system. In 16 years the company has grown to become a nationwide provider of software solutions that serve over 2,000 medical practices and healthcare providers.

The company’s PracticeStudio® system combines two systems – ChartPower® and PracticeWizard® to deliver a proven and powerful practice management solution that utilizes touch screen and voice technology to provide a comprehensive and integrated electronic medical record (EMR) and office management system.

MicroFour was a pioneer in the development of EMR systems for physician practices. They were also one of the first companies in the U. S. to integrate the EMR with a practice management system, providing an end-to-end solution for their clients.

“I reviewed 63 different systems before I selected PracticeStudio,” said Dr. Charlie Ruby, a family practice physician in Midlothian, TX. “I wanted a true EMR that was integrated with a complete practice management system. With this system, I can manage the entire patient encounter at the point of care. When my patients leave the exam room, I’m finished; no further dictation is required. At the same time, PracticeStudio efficiently handles all my accounts receivable, billing, insurance claims and patient statement processing,” Dr. Ruby continued
